/priːədʒʊdɪˈkeɪʃən dɪˈtɛnʃən/ – Phrase
Definition: tống giam trước khi tuyên án.
A more thorough explanation: Preadjudication detention refers to the period of time before a formal legal decision or judgment has been made in a case, during which a person is held in custody or detained pending the resolution of their legal proceedings.
Example: The suspect was held in preadjudication detention pending the outcome of their trial.
